1 Input
Coinbase
Block Reward
033ec5000101
1 Output - 500,000.00260568 PEPE
500,000.00260568
PEPE
Output #0
Script: 2102cc8b93324fac04c4535f5e51b25d5b49ca74e0f16efc607d06193be42cf5c9b6ac